HONDA ACCORD 2006 CL7 / 7.G Owners Manual To thoroughly f lush the transmission, 
the technician should drain and ref ill
it with Honda ATF-Z1 (Automatic
Transmission Fluid), then drive the
vehicle f or a short distance. Do this
three times.

HONDA ACCORD 2006 CL7 / 7.G Owners Manual Check the level on the side of the 
reservoir when the engine is cold.
The f luid should be between the
UPPER LEVEL and LOWER LEVEL.
